Dons Try-ed and Tested by College Students
Championship One side Doncaster RLFC
pre-season has been boosted by students from the Doncaster College
Rugby Academy.
The lads were put through a series of fitness
tests by the three of the College’s Academy students at their
training base in Lindholme.
The tests included various aspects of fitness,
including body fat percentage, leg power, grip strength, agility,
acceleration, muscular endurance and aerobic fitness, using the
College’s state-of-the-art testing equipment.
Don’s Head Coach Tony Miller said “The players
have received the results and we will now devise their individual
programmes from those results.”
Pete Holmes, Lecturer in Sports and Exercise
Science at the College stated “It’s fantastic for the lads to work
behind the scenes at a professional sports club and to have an
influence on how the club performs in the coming season.”
